| Established | Regulatory Authority | Headquarters | Minimum Deposit | Leverage Ratio | Average Spread |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2020 | None | Bengaluru, India | $100 | Up to 1:500 | 1.2 pips |
HyperTrade was established in 2020 and operates without any regulatory oversight, which may raise concerns for potential traders. The broker is headquartered in Bengaluru, India, and requires a minimum deposit of $100 to open an account. With a leverage ratio of up to 1:500, traders can amplify their positions significantly, but this also introduces higher risks. The average spread of 1.2 pips is competitive compared to many industry peers, which typically range from 1.0 to 2.0 pips.
When evaluating the trading conditions, it is crucial to note that while HyperTrade offers attractive leverage, the absence of regulatory oversight may deter some traders who prioritize safety and compliance. Overall, the trading conditions are on par with industry standards, particularly for those seeking higher leverage options.

| Currency Pair Category | Number Offered | Minimum Spread | Trading Hours | Commission Structure |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Major Currency Pairs | 20 | 1.0 pips | 24/5 | Variable |
| Minor Currency Pairs | 15 | 1.5 pips | 24/5 | Variable |
| Exotic Currency Pairs | 10 | 2.0 pips | 24/5 | Variable |
HyperTrade provides a diverse array of currency pairs, including 20 major pairs with a minimum spread of 1.0 pips, making it suitable for traders who prefer high liquidity. The minor pairs come with a slightly wider spread of 1.5 pips, while exotic pairs may have spreads as high as 2.0 pips. The trading hours are flexible, operating 24 hours a day, five days a week, aligning with the forex market's global nature.

For traders looking to utilize HyperTrade's platform effectively, a simple yet effective strategy is the "Moving Average Crossover" approach. This strategy involves using two moving averages—a short-term (e.g., 10-period) and a long-term (e.g., 50-period)—to identify potential buy and sell signals. When the short-term moving average crosses above the long-term moving average, it indicates a buy signal, while a crossover below suggests a sell signal.
